* [PATCH 1/3] perf: Remove duplicate invocation on perf_event_for_each
@ 2012-05-31  5:51 Namhyung Kim
  2012-05-31  5:51 ` [PATCH 2/3] perf tools: Update ioctl documentation for PERF_IOC_FLAG_GROUP Namhyung Kim
                   ` (3 more replies)
  0 siblings, 4 replies; 9+ messages in thread
From: Namhyung Kim @ 2012-05-31  5:51 UTC (permalink / raw)
  To: Arnaldo Carvalho de Melo
  Cc: Peter Zijlstra, Paul Mackerras, Ingo Molnar, Namhyung Kim, LKML

The @func callback was invoked twice for group leader
when perf_event_for_each() called. It seems the commit
75f937f24bd9 ("perf_counter: Fix ctx->mutex vs counter
->mutex inversion") made the mistake during the change.

Signed-off-by: Namhyung Kim <namhyung.kim@lge.com>
---
 kernel/events/core.c |    1 -
 1 file changed, 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/kernel/events/core.c b/kernel/events/core.c
index 5b06cbbf6931..f85c0154b333 100644
--- a/kernel/events/core.c
+++ b/kernel/events/core.c
@@ -3181,7 +3181,6 @@ static void perf_event_for_each(struct perf_event *event,
 	event = event->group_leader;
 
 	perf_event_for_each_child(event, func);
-	func(event);
 	list_for_each_entry(sibling, &event->sibling_list, group_entry)
 		perf_event_for_each_child(sibling, func);
 	mutex_unlock(&ctx->mutex);

* [PATCH 2/3] perf tools: Update ioctl documentation for PERF_IOC_FLAG_GROUP
  2012-05-31  5:51 [PATCH 1/3] perf: Remove duplicate invocation on perf_event_for_each Namhyung Kim
@ 2012-05-31  5:51 ` Namhyung Kim
  2012-05-31 14:35   ` Arnaldo Carvalho de Melo
  2012-06-06  7:03   ` [tip:perf/urgent] " tip-bot for Namhyung Kim
  2012-05-31  5:51 ` [PATCH 3/3] perf evlist: Pass third argument to ioctl explicitly Namhyung Kim
                   ` (2 subsequent siblings)
  3 siblings, 2 replies; 9+ messages in thread
From: Namhyung Kim @ 2012-05-31  5:51 UTC (permalink / raw)
  To: Arnaldo Carvalho de Melo
  Cc: Peter Zijlstra, Paul Mackerras, Ingo Molnar, Namhyung Kim, LKML

The ioctl interface of perf event fd receives 3 arguments
to control event group behavior but it lacked documentation.

Signed-off-by: Namhyung Kim <namhyung.kim@lge.com>
---
 tools/perf/design.txt |    7 ++++---
 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)

diff --git a/tools/perf/design.txt b/tools/perf/design.txt
index bd0bb1b1279b..67e5d0cace85 100644
--- a/tools/perf/design.txt
+++ b/tools/perf/design.txt
@@ -409,14 +409,15 @@ Counters can be enabled and disabled in two ways: via ioctl and via
 prctl.  When a counter is disabled, it doesn't count or generate
 events but does continue to exist and maintain its count value.
 
-An individual counter or counter group can be enabled with
+An individual counter can be enabled with
 
-	ioctl(fd, PERF_EVENT_IOC_ENABLE);
+	ioctl(fd, PERF_EVENT_IOC_ENABLE, 0);
 
 or disabled with
 
-	ioctl(fd, PERF_EVENT_IOC_DISABLE);
+	ioctl(fd, PERF_EVENT_IOC_DISABLE, 0);
 
+For a counter group, pass PERF_IOC_FLAG_GROUP as the third argument.
 Enabling or disabling the leader of a group enables or disables the
 whole group; that is, while the group leader is disabled, none of the
 counters in the group will count.  Enabling or disabling a member of a

* [PATCH 3/3] perf evlist: Pass third argument to ioctl explicitly
  2012-05-31  5:51 [PATCH 1/3] perf: Remove duplicate invocation on perf_event_for_each Namhyung Kim
  2012-05-31  5:51 ` [PATCH 2/3] perf tools: Update ioctl documentation for PERF_IOC_FLAG_GROUP Namhyung Kim
@ 2012-05-31  5:51 ` Namhyung Kim
  2012-06-06  7:04   ` [tip:perf/urgent] " tip-bot for Namhyung Kim
  2012-05-31 17:00 ` [PATCH 1/3] perf: Remove duplicate invocation on perf_event_for_each Peter Zijlstra
  2012-06-06  7:09 ` [tip:perf/urgent] " tip-bot for Namhyung Kim
  3 siblings, 1 reply; 9+ messages in thread
From: Namhyung Kim @ 2012-05-31  5:51 UTC (permalink / raw)
  To: Arnaldo Carvalho de Melo
  Cc: Peter Zijlstra, Paul Mackerras, Ingo Molnar, Namhyung Kim, LKML

The ioctl on perf event fd wants 3 arguments but we only
passed 2. As the only user of the functions is perf record
and it calls them for every events (regardless of group
setting), just pass 0 for now.

Signed-off-by: Namhyung Kim <namhyung.kim@lge.com>
---
 tools/perf/util/evlist.c |    6 ++++--
 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

diff --git a/tools/perf/util/evlist.c b/tools/perf/util/evlist.c
index 4ac5f5ae4ce9..244211070264 100644
--- a/tools/perf/util/evlist.c
+++ b/tools/perf/util/evlist.c
@@ -263,7 +263,8 @@ void perf_evlist__disable(struct perf_evlist *evlist)
 	for (cpu = 0; cpu < evlist->cpus->nr; cpu++) {
 		list_for_each_entry(pos, &evlist->entries, node) {
 			for (thread = 0; thread < evlist->threads->nr; thread++)
-				ioctl(FD(pos, cpu, thread), PERF_EVENT_IOC_DISABLE);
+				ioctl(FD(pos, cpu, thread),
+				      PERF_EVENT_IOC_DISABLE, 0);
 		}
 	}
 }
@@ -276,7 +277,8 @@ void perf_evlist__enable(struct perf_evlist *evlist)
 	for (cpu = 0; cpu < evlist->cpus->nr; cpu++) {
 		list_for_each_entry(pos, &evlist->entries, node) {
 			for (thread = 0; thread < evlist->threads->nr; thread++)
-				ioctl(FD(pos, cpu, thread), PERF_EVENT_IOC_ENABLE);
+				ioctl(FD(pos, cpu, thread),
+				      PERF_EVENT_IOC_ENABLE, 0);
 		}
 	}
 }
